The problem you are having is with this file:
<OOo directory>/program/senddoc. It contains the scripts needed to
send a document from OOo. It does not contain a script for Mutt, and
that is why you get the message. Trying to use Seamonkey will give
the same error while Mozilla, Netscape, and Thunderbird have
scripts. (There is a simple addition to the senddoc to make it work.)
Mutt could be made to work, but it would require someone to create
the script needed for it. Then adding the script to senddoc would
solve the problem.
